<!-- springboot maven 打包-- 1:以下build 放进pom.xml中;finalName是包名 -- 2: maven build,第一次打包的话会弹出上面的框...; <finalName>;trysite</finalName>; <plugins>; <plugin>; <groupId>spring boot 打包成jar 包在发布到服务器上 (NoClass/ClassNotFound等问题解决...
tools.A 这里要 `tools.A` 是默认的一个main方法的类完整名(包名.类型) 如何启动 1.执行默认的main()方法 也就是上面tools.A中的main方法 那么就是java -jar xxxxxxx.jar 他就会执行 A类中的main方法 2.手动指定某个类的main()方法 -jar 换成-cp 然后.jar 后面要指定完整类路径(包.类) 如果要执行B...
--jar包名--><pack-name>${project.artifactId}-${project.version}.jar</pack-name> 要么在打包时指定jar包的名字来符合之前的标准也是一样 这样就算是成功了 image.png 那么到服务器上找找上传的jar包吧,在/work/demo1中已经已经存在jar包,上传成功! image.png wagon的运行功能 其实还可以使用wagon来自动...
重命名功能也是maven-shade-plugin插件的一个重要功能,这个功能可以对项目中或依赖中的包名进行重命名,包名重命名后还会把引用的地方一并修改,非常方便 这个功能的使用场景,主要是版本冲突,举个例子吧,前置条件如下: 我们的项目 A 中引用了commons-lang3,另一个需要依赖我们项目的工程 B 也引入了commons-lang3 两...
依赖冲突:如果本地 JAR 文件与其他依赖项存在冲突(例如,它们包含相同的类或包名),可能会导致构建失败或运行时错误。在这种情况下,你可能需要解决这些冲突,例如通过排除某些传递性依赖或重新打包 JAR 文件。 插件版本:确保你使用的 maven-dependency-plugin 版本是最新的,或者至少是一个兼容你当前 Maven 版本的版本。
指定Main-Class:可以通过配置选项指定可执行jar文件的入口类,使得jar文件可以直接运行。 重命名冲突的类:当项目的依赖中存在相同包名和类名的类时,可以通过配置选项指定重命名规则,避免冲突。 排除不需要的类或资源:可以通过配置选项排除项目中不需要打包的类或资源,减小最终jar文件的大小。
...方法二:将待引入的jar包安装到本地repository中 1、先把待引入的jar包放在一个目录下,需要改一下包名,如fbcds.jar修改成fbcds-1.0.jar,如F:\lib目录,在命令行...MAVEN如何打可执行的JAR包 前提条件:已成功将待引入的jar包安装到本地repository中 方法一、使用maven-shade-plugin插件打可执行的...
切换Android系统并拉起应用 应用场景 本接口用于Windows系统切换安卓系统时使用。 前提条件 已完成登录认证,参考登录认证。 接口概述 本接口通过传递类名和包名,将Windows系统切换至安卓系统并拉起应用。接口详情请参考切换到Android系统并拉起应用 请求URL /action ...
1、先把待引入的jar包放在一个目录下,需要改一下包名,如fbcds.jar修改成fbcds-1.0.jar,如F:\lib目录,在命令行CD到lib目录,执行以下命令: 1。mvn install:install-file -Dfile=fbcds-1.0.jar -DgroupId=fbcds -DartifactId=fbcds -Dversion=1.0 -Dpackaging=jar2. mvn install:install-file -Dfile=ojd...
涉及标签: <pattern>:原始包名 <shadedPattern>:重命名后的包名 <excludes>:原始包内不需要重定位的类,类名支持通配符 例如,在上述示例中,我们把 org.codehaus.plexus.util 包内的所有子包及 class 文件(除了 ~.xml.Xpp3Dom 和 ~.xml.pull 包下的所有 class 文件)重定位到了 org.shaded.plexus.util 包内...